Sturgill Simpson :: Sound + Fury

Sturgill Simpson :: Sound + Fury

Simpson made a name for himself with introspective Americana, but this injects a confusing high-energy EDM element, with mixed results. I imagine die-hard ZZ Top fans felt the same way about “Eliminator”.

Peel Dream Magazine :: Rose Main Reading Room

Peel Dream Magazine :: Rose Main Reading Room

Is it the analog synthesizer flourishes, or the gentle delivery with an aggressive intent, or the seamless shuttling between disparate elements that shouldn't work together? The band sounds perfectly familiar, yet completely its own thing.
